Poster Design Tips and Principles
Why posters?
• Help you get your work across in a very
concise way
• Common dissemination tool in many
disciplines – a good skill to have
• A research output that we can use
Poster Design Tips and Principles
The poster session
• A busy, noisy room with up to 50 other posters
• Specialist and non-specialist viewers
• People look at posters for an average of 90
seconds. May decide in 10 seconds how much they
want to engage at all
• Make it visually interesting and easy to understand
at a glance
Poster Design Tips and Principles
• Powerpoint is often the easiest option– Design Tab, Page Setup – customise the size of
the poster• A2 = 59.4cm x 42cm• A1 = 84.1cm x 59.4cm• A0 = 118.9cm x 84.1cm
– In most instances landscape is better than
portrait.
• Other options for design, include Adobe
Illustrator/Photoshop and InDesign – but require
software and know-how
Poster Design Tips and Principles
• No matter what size you choose – no more than 1000 words!
• Fonts:– Sans Serif fonts (Arial, Helvetica, Calibri)
are easier to read, and should be used for headings
– Serif fonts (Times New Roman etc.) are fine for body text.
– 22 point font size is a minimum.• Instead of using words, think of ways in
which you can use photographs, cartoons or illustrations to illustrate your concept.
